While you can constantly choose a car maintenance course to learn the basics, this is isn't necessary as you can quickly do most of your car upkeep with no advanced mechanical understanding. A helpful resource you can turn to which will tell you all you need to understand about your automobile is your car maintenance book. This will have all the necessary information that are specific to your vehicle so there will be no need for any guesswork. For example, your handbook will tell you the perfect air pressure for you tyres so you can pump up and deflate when required. It will also inform you how much your tires would usually last, that way, you know when it's time to change them. Whether you've owned several automobiles already or you've just purchased your very first vehicle, there is much you can do to keep you car maintenance cost down. By discovering the basics of automobile maintenance DIY, you can quickly swerve many charges by doing the simpler upkeep tasks yourself in the house. For instance, you can quickly top up your liquids when needed and buy them online instead of an auto shop. For instance, examining the levels of your coolant and wiper fluids only takes a few seconds, and if you discover that you're running a little low, you can always top up from your own supply. Likewise, topping up your brake and power steering fluids is a procedure that is easy enough for any adult to sort. Automobile owners often spend a great deal of money and time on the performance side of things while ignoring the aesthetics of the car. The visual appeal of your vehicle is likewise important as it can help slow down depreciation, suggesting that your car would have more value when it looks its best. To ensure that you're constantly on top of the aesthetics of your vehicle, you can establish a car maintenance schedule. This should include a deep clean of the car, focusing not just on the outside, but also the interiors.
